Open-collector NAND in the 74LS family

The SN74LS38N is a quad 2-input NAND gate from Texas Instruments' 74LS low-power Schottky family, with open-collector outputs that sink up to 24 mA per channel.

What the open-collector output means for your circuit

The open-collector output on each of the four gates can only sink current to ground — it cannot source current. The high-level output is pulled up by an external resistor, so the SN74LS38N is the natural choice for wired-AND busses, level translation to a higher voltage rail, or driving loads like relays and LEDs that need a current sink. Input logic thresholds are standard 74LS: a low below 0.8 V is recognised as a logic 0, and a high above 2 V as a logic 1, with the 5 V supply rail providing the typical 0.8 V noise margin on the low side.

The SN74LS38N comes in a 14-pin plastic DIP (0.300-inch body width, 7.62 mm) with a through-hole mounting style. The 14-PDIP supplier package code matches the standard 0.100-inch pitch DIP footprint that has been a breadboard and PCB mainstay for decades. It ships in a tube — no tape-and-reel, so expect a straight through-hole assembly process without needing a reel feeder.

It is ROHS3 compliant, meeting the latest EU restriction-of-hazardous-substances directive for lead-free soldering processes.

Will SN74LS38N drop into a board designed for SN74LVC2G132DCUR?

No — the SN74LVC2G132DCUR is a surface-mount, dual 2-input NAND with Schmitt-trigger inputs in a much smaller package, while the SN74LS38N is a through-hole 14-pin DIP quad gate. The pinout, supply voltage range, and logic family are different; a board spin or adapter is required.
